A BOISTEROUS border terrier has been dubbed as one of Britain friendliest dogs after winning a place on a calendar in a national competition.

Vanessa Holbrow from Burnham-on-Sea entered her dog, 'Sir Jack Spratticus', into Dog Friendly's 2018 calendar competition earlier this year and said she was 'shellshocked' when she discovered the border terrier had won a place on the calendar.

"I shed a tear when I found out that Jack was going to appear on the calendar, I never thought in a million years that we would win,"she said.

The proud dog owner entered Jack in the Dog Friendly Face of the Year competition earlier this year and was thrilled when she checked the Dog Friendly website and discovered that Jack had won a spot on the 2018 calendar.

For winning, Jack has secured a spot on the 2018 Dog Friendly calendar and has won a £250 holiday voucher and a professional photoshoot.

Vanessa said she was called on September 9 by a representative from Dog Friendly and was told that Jack had been shortlisted to be on the calendar.

"When I got the call I was so surprised, I enter a few photo competitions every year and I wasn't expecting to hear anything back," she said.

"The representative asked me a few questions about Jack and told me to look out for the results.

"I couldn't believe my eyes when I looked on the website and found that Jack had won, I'm so proud of him."

Vanessa said she is looking forward to using the holiday vouchers as she has never been away and wants to enjoy a holiday with Jack.

"I unfortunately don't have any family left in the UK and suffer with a variety of illnesses which have led to me being in and out of hospital for long periods," she said.

"Jack is so understanding and caring and we have such a close relationship that I would love for us to go away.

"I am currently training Jack so he can be an assistance dog for me and as he is an older dog he has to work twice as hard.

"I am so grateful to have Jack in my life, he is a fantastic partner."
